Hey HALLIEBETH,
Glad you've got good stuff going on, but sorry to hear you're sad. I have some thoughts: First, could it be that you're so not used to having good stuff happen that you are unsure whether you deserve it, so you're feeling sad as a kind of punishment? Second, could you have been expecting more? More elation? Sustained elation? Finally, are you afraid something bad will happen to ruin your happiness, so you are preemptively feeling sad? Just brainstorming... |

@HALLIEBETH87 congratulations on your marriage. Sorry you are sad.
The reason I have emotions bubble up is usually because I have expectations that are over the top unrealistic. Unfortunately things change. Relationships especially. If you are looking for an option to deal with this, I would try writing a list of your expecatations of the marriage relationship and talk to your therapist about them and see what happens.
